Edgar "Ed" Douglas Castle

Edgar "Ed" Douglas Castle, age 73, of Castalia, Ohio, passed away peacefully Saturday, December 4, 2021 after a long illness, with his family by his side.

Ed was born on August 10, 1948 in Paintsville, Kentucky, daughter of Edgar A. and Anna Nova (Salyer) Castle.

Ed was a proud Army Veteran stationed in Fort Rutger, Alabama from 1968-1970 and retired from Norfolk Southern Railway after 30 years of service. He was known for his love of life and outgoing personality. In his younger years, he played competitive softball in Sandusky, Ohio. Throughout his life, he loved fishing for perch and walleye on Lake Erie, hunting, and gardening. Ed was also an avid supporter of the Margaretta Lady Bears basketball team. Ed loved spending time at his cabin in Southern Ohio hunting with his friends and nephew, Kyle Calhoun. He also enjoyed having breakfast with his friends in Castalia each week. He loved spending time with his three grandchildren and teaching them about nature. He was an active member of the Concord Church in Paintsville, Kentucky and Little Bethlehem church in Bellevue, Ohio.

Ed is survived by his wife of 51 years, Virginia Greene Castle, daughters Dr. Amy (Dave) Elleman of Thompson's Station, Tennessee and Dr. Jennifer (William) Parrish of Greeley, Colorado, and three grandchildren Samantha Elleman, Alyssa Elleman, and Shannon Parrish. He is also survived by his sister Darnell King (Steven Collins) and three brothers, Jerry (Mary) Castle, James "Jim" (Kay) Castle, and Roger (Sharon) Castle.

In addition to his parents, Ed was preceded in death by his five sisters, Rosetta, Jeanett, Doris, Shirley, and Alice, and two brothers, Paul and Gary.
